SOSD2D may be a good fit for clients that can tolerate 2-3 hours of downtime to arrange the backup AS/400 "failover" and can tolerate losing up to 3-6 hours of data between the production server failure point and last data transmission between production and target servers. The recovery window is about 3-6 hours.
How Does SOSD2D Work?
1) Hardware is fitted to client needs and a designated dedicated AS400 or iSeries i5 partition is assigned to client. Synergistic hardware or LPAR may be utilized or client's hardware.
2) Communication backbone is established, utilizing client protocols, VPN connections, ecrypted routers, and DSL, T1, Frame Relay, and industry specific connectivity such as ANX may be accomodated.
3) Synergistic engineers work closely with client to determine which applications, objects, and data are to be transmitted and at what intervals.
4) Synergistic AS400 Engineers work with client to customize the solution, designating a 4,8,12, or 24 hour data synchronization window, where client's production AS/400 transmits data to their backup AS/400 in the Synergistic Data Center.
5) Solution is implemented and "goes live". Daily, Weekly, Monthly, and Annual tests are run to insure viability and accurate data replication. Planned downtimes may be scheduled to be "failed over" to Synergistic Data Center.
6) Upon a disaster declaration, client has an iSeries AS400 high availability solution ready and is just hours away from recovery of operations: The hardware is in place, the communication backbone is established, the data is nearly live.
